KYZYL, June 6 (Itar-Tass) - The Tuva Prosecutor’s Office is conducting an inquiry in the death of a 15-year-old teenager at the detention centre, the press service of the republican prosecutor’s office told Itar-Tass on Thursday.

The arrested teenager was found dead in the evening on Wednesday, June 5, in a ward of the detention centre number one in Tuva, the prosecutor’s office said.

The senior aide of the Tuva prosecutor over the supervision for the observance of the laws in the administering of the verdicts for criminal offences arrived at the incident site. The preliminary inquiry showed that the teenager died of suffocation, the prosecutor’s office added.

The prosecutor’s office explained that the teenager from the village Toora-Khema in the Todzha district was detained on May 30 on the suspicion of murder. On the next day the court ruled to put him in arrest, the accusation was brought against him for murder under Article 105 Part 1 of the Russian Criminal Code on June 1.
